Password-protect a PDF online
This tool adds a password to a PDF with strong AES-256 encryption, so only people who know the password can open it. The encryption is applied with qpdf on our server, and your file and password are deleted the moment the protected PDF is returned.

Frequently Asked Questions
How strong is the encryption?
The PDF is encrypted with 256-bit AES, the strongest standard PDF encryption. Choose a long, unique password for the best protection.
What happens to my password?
It is used only to encrypt your file during the request and is never stored or logged. It is discarded along with your file as soon as the download is sent.
Can I recover the PDF if I forget the password?
No. Without the password the file cannot be opened, so keep it somewhere safe.
